9.3 Validating the Parameter File

The information in this chapter is also included in the Commissioning report. After the commissioning of the system with the option
board, validate the parameter file stored in the option board.
Procedure
1.
Select "Validate" in the VACON
2.
Fill in the validation data.
3.
Save the validation data to the option board.
4.
Reboot the AC drive.
a.
The warning on a not validated parameter file disappears.
5.
Make sure that the Commissioning report is filled correctly and archive it.

9.4 Checklist before Taking the System into Use

The system can be taken into use after these conditions are fulfilled:
The AC drive is parameterized and commissioned.
The commissioning of the option board is completed.
-
The option board is parameterized.
-
The used safety functions and features have been tested.
-
The parameter file of the option board is validated.
Other related subsystems have been correctly commissioned.
Other safety-related systems that were modified or disabled for the commissioning are enabled or returned to the normal oper-
ation mode.

9.5 Bypassing Safety Features

BYPASS HAZARD
When the Advanced safety option board is bypassed, it does not provide any safety functions.
-
Consider carefully before bypassing the Advanced safety option board.
While not strictly required, it is recommended to return the parameter P7.4.1.2.1 to its default value "Default" after the commis-
sioning activities.
If the Advanced safety option board is installed in the AC drive with an STO board and the AC drive itself has not been commis-
sioned, it may be preferable to bypass the safety functions of the Advanced safety option to make the commissioning simpler. To
bypass the safety functions of the Advanced safety option, do these steps.
